Port Vale vs Yeovil Town preview - Remie right up Vale's Streete



Posted Friday, October 10, 2014 by PA

Port Vale could hand teenager Remie Streete a professional debut after he finalised a loan move from Newcastle.

The 19-year-old defender completed his move in time to go straight into the squad to face Yeovil.

Jordan Slew remains on the sidelines as he sits out the second game of a three-match ban.

Ryan McGivern is away on international duty with Ronald Zubar set to continue after making his debut in the midweek loss to Preston. Another loan signing, Reiss Greenidge, could also feature with manager Rob Page suggesting he may make changes.

Yeovil will be without defender Ben Nugent when they make the trip.

The Cardiff loanee picked up two yellow cards in last weekend's clash with MK Dons and will sit out with former Liverpool man Jakub Sokolik most likely to step in.

Gary Johnson has also bid farewell to Jack Price after the Wolves loanee played his final game of his loan stay and subsequently joined Leyton Orient, while Joel Grant looks unlikely to start as he will travel to Japan with the Jamaica squad and back to Huish Park before kick-off.

The likes of Brendan Moloney and Liam Davis are likely to come into contention while Kieffer Moore's hamstring injury will be assessed.
